英文摘要We investigate the omnidirectional absorption enhancement induced by the excitation of the localized surface plasmon in the hybrid system consisting of a gold nanowire array embedded in a slab waveguide. assisted by the waveguide layer, the hybrid system can support the localized waveguide-plasmon resonances for a wide range of incident angles. theoretical and experimental results are both presented to demonstrate the omnidirectional absorption enhancement which could find important applications on plasmonic-assisted photovoltaic devices or photodetectors.
